I have a model 917.274953 21 hp 46" craftsman garden tractor. I have replaced the Motion Drive V Belt according to the diagram in my manual.  Now the gears don't operate properly.  When I put it in reverse, it moves forward. When I put it in any forward gear, it goes into reverse.  Is this a transmission problem or did I install the belt incorrectly?

Answer

   Hello,

   Yes, the drive belt has to be on the wrong way and the transmission pulley is being driven backwards.  It's not a transmission problem.  Recheck the diagram to make sure you have it exactly as shown, or else the diagram is wrong.  I see lots of mistakes in manuals.  If you still can't make it work correctly, contact a small engine / mower repair shop, or contact Sears service.
